Barbados
Barbados is known as "little England" and offers everything from beaches to the bustling capital of "Bridgetown". Barbados is almost one continuos stretch of white sandy beaches. You will find more luxury hotels here than in any other Caribbean island. Barbados with its calm waters, white beaches and glitzy night spots draws in those rich and famous every year. It is a popular for a honeymoon, with its climate, beaches and the warm friendly people. It has everything for those couples you want to lie on the beach and relax, to those sporty couples, you can do everything from playing golf to watching cricket and going to the opera. Barbados is one of the friendliest, welcoming and most British of Caribbean Islands.
Cuisine Barbados offers a variety of cuisine. Today you can sample Italian, French, Chinese and Bajan foods. Bajan food are dishes such as pepperpot, a stew which is well seasoned other dishes are fish and rice. Barbados is famous for its rum "Mount Gay" which is produced on the island. It comes in various strengths from strong to very strong and is often used in cocktails.

Currency Barbados Dollar
Flight Time 9 hours
GMT Time Difference GMT -4 hours.
Language English is the official language.
Visas Not required.
Health Hepatitis A, Polio, Tetanus and Typhoid vaccinations are recommended.
